Evestay - the convener for the Buchanan Clan Tent is Bill and Gina McQuatters a very good friend of mine. They will give you a warm welcome and mention Dave from Connecticut. They will have Clan t shirts for sale, I don't know about anything else. For the most part festival organizers don't like clan tents selling scarfs, clan badges etc. The vendors pay to be on site and the competition isn't fair to them but they should have those item available for you. You should have a great time.
Most clan tents don't offer specific genealogy help. The field is too broad and requires too many specifics. They will provide history and traditions of the clan and background information on the various surnames associated with the clan. Some conveners may be able to give you some general advice on how to proceed but that would vary from tent to tent.

1st October 15, 07:20 AM
#28
Bbsb
BBSB refers to black Barathea (a type of wool fabric) with silver buttons.
